How Our Proven Smoke Odor Removal Process Works
Getting rid of smoke odor isn’t as simple as opening windows or spraying air fresheners. Those temporary fixes often fail because smoke particles embed themselves deep within walls, carpets, and even your HVAC system. Our team follows a meticulous, multi-step process designed to address the root cause of the odor. We’ve seen what happens when corners are cut – lingering smells that return, causing frustration and further expense. Our approach ensures a complete odor elimination, giving you back your clean-smelling home.
Initial Assessment and Inspection
The first step is a thorough inspection of your property to identify all affected areas and the extent of smoke intrusion. We use specialized tools to detect hidden odor sources, ensuring no area is overlooked. This assessment helps us create a targeted plan for effective odor removal.
Content Cleaning and Deodorization
Our crews carefully clean all affected surfaces, including walls, ceilings, furniture, and belongings. We use specialized cleaning agents that break down smoke residue without damaging your materials. This stage is crucial for removing the odor source.
Air Scrubbing and Filtration
We employ industrial-grade air scrubbers and ozone generators to capture and neutralize airborne odor particles. These machines work continuously to purify your indoor air, significantly reducing the lingering smell. This step is vital for improving air quality.
HVAC System Cleaning
Smoke often travels through your ventilation system, contaminating the entire house. We offer professional HVAC cleaning to ensure smoke odors don’t recirculate through your ducts. This prevents the smell from returning and ensures clean, fresh air.
Sealing and Painting (If Necessary)
In cases of severe smoke damage, we may recommend sealing porous surfaces with specialized primers before painting. This creates a barrier that locks away any remaining odor molecules. This final step provides long-term odor protection.

Warning Signs You Need Professional Smoke Odor Removal
Ignoring early signs of smoke odor can lead to more significant problems and higher costs down the line. The sooner you address persistent smells, the easier and more effective the removal process will be. Catching these signals early saves you time and ensures a truly fresh environment.
Lingering Acrid Smell
If you notice a persistent smoky or burnt smell that doesn’t dissipate after airing out your home, it’s a clear sign that smoke particles have penetrated surfaces. This isn’t just a surface issue; it requires deeper odor treatment.
Discoloration on Surfaces
Soot and smoke residue can leave visible yellow or brown stains on walls, ceilings, and even fabrics. These stains are often accompanied by strong odors that typical cleaning won’t remove. This visual cue indicates stubborn residue.
Unpleasant Odors in Fabrics
Carpets, upholstery, curtains, and even clothing can absorb smoke odors intensely. If washing or dry cleaning doesn’t eliminate the smell from your textiles, professional treatment is likely needed. Your fabrics need specialized odor care.
Smoke Smell in HVAC Vents
When you turn on your heating or cooling system and a smoke smell emerges from the vents, it means smoke has infiltrated your ductwork. This requires immediate attention to prevent the odor from spreading throughout your entire home. Your HVAC needs thorough cleaning.
Headaches or Respiratory Irritation
Inhaling smoke particles can cause irritation and health issues. If you or your family members are experiencing unexplained headaches, coughing, or breathing difficulties, it could be due to residual smoke odor. Your health deserves clean indoor air.
Persistent Musty or Burnt Odors After Cleaning Attempts
You’ve tried everything – scrubbing, airing out, using commercial cleaners – but the smoky smell remains. This indicates the odor is deeply embedded and requires professional-grade equipment and techniques for complete odor eradication.
Smoke Odor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Light kitchen smoke from burnt toast | Yes, usually | No, typically | Airing out and surface cleaning often suffice for minor incidents. |
| Lingering smell after a small appliance fire | Maybe | Yes, often | Smoke particles can be deeper than they appear, requiring specialized treatment. |
| Odor after a chimney fire or fireplace use | No, not recommended | Yes | Soot and creosote odors are highly invasive and require professional-grade deodorizers. |
| Smoke odor from a wildfire affecting your home | No | Yes, absolutely | Wildfire smoke is extremely potent and penetrates deeply into building materials and contents. |
| Smoke smell in HVAC system | No | Yes | Professional cleaning is essential to prevent odor recirculation and ensure system integrity. |
| Odor from electrical fire or structural fire | No | Yes, immediately | These fires produce complex chemical residues and deep-seated odors requiring advanced restoration techniques. |

Smoke Odor Removal Cost In Serra Mesa, CA
The cost for smoke odor removal in Serra Mesa, CA can vary significantly based on the size of the affected area, the severity of the smoke damage, and the types of materials that need treatment. These figures are meant to give you a general idea of what to expect for professional services in the area. We always provide transparent pricing estimates.
| Service Aspect |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Inspection and Assessment | $200 – $500 | Complexity of the smoke source and extent of affected areas. |
| Surface Cleaning and Deodorization (per room) | $300 – $1,000 | Size of the room and the amount of smoke residue present. |
| Content Cleaning and Restoration (per item/batch) | $500 – $3,000+ | Number of items, material type, and depth of odor penetration. |
| Air Scrubbing and Ozone Treatment (per day/area) | $400 – $1,200 | Size of the space being treated and duration of treatment needed. |
| HVAC System Deodorization | $500 – $1,500 | Number of vents, complexity of the ductwork, and type of treatment used. |
| Sealing and Priming (per room) | $300 – $800 | Square footage of walls and ceilings needing sealant application. |

Common Questions About Smoke Odor Removal
How long does smoke odor removal usually take?
The timeline for smoke odor removal depends heavily on the severity of the smoke damage. Minor odors might be resolved in 1-3 days with targeted treatments. For more extensive smoke intrusion, it could take up to a week or longer to fully deodorize your property. We work efficiently to restore your home quickly.
Will insurance cover smoke odor removal costs?
In many cases, smoke odor removal stemming from a covered event like a fire is covered by homeowner’s insurance. It’s always best to check your specific policy details. We can help document the damage and work with your adjuster to ensure you receive the coverage you’re entitled to for complete odor remediation.
Is smoke odor removal safe for pets and children?
Yes, the methods and products we use are safe once the treatment is complete and the area is properly ventilated. We take great care to select deodorizing agents that are effective against smoke but pose no long-term risk to your family or pets. Your safety is our priority, and we ensure a healthy living environment.
What is the most effective method for removing smoke odor from furniture?
For furniture, effective smoke odor removal often involves a combination of professional cleaning and specialized deodorizing techniques. This can include deep cleaning of upholstery, treating wood surfaces with odor counteractants, and sometimes ozone treatments for heavily impacted items. We focus on restoring your belongings.
Can I prevent smoke odors from returning after treatment?
Proper ventilation, regular cleaning of surfaces, and maintaining your HVAC system can help prevent the recurrence of smoke odors. If the initial damage was severe, we may recommend sealing porous surfaces like drywall or subflooring. We provide guidance on maintaining a fresh home.
